The Book for Students in A Class in Wonders consists of 365 lessons, one for each day of the year. These classes are designed to help students internalize the teachings and apply them for their everyday lives. They usually include meditative and contemplative workouts, affirmations, and reflections on the concepts shown in the text. The objective of these everyday classes would be to change the student's notion and attitude gradually, primary them towards a state of true forgiveness, inner peace, and spiritual awakening.

The Guide for Educators, the 3rd component of ACIM, is directed at those people who have embraced the concepts of the Program and sense forced to generally share them with others. It offers advice on the features of a real instructor of God, emphasizing qualities such as patience, confidence, and an start heart. It acknowledges the issues and obstacles one may encounter while training the Program and offers insights on how to understand them.
